Libel

Libel is a type of defamation that occurs when someone makes a false statement about another person or entity in a written or published form, such as in newspapers, books, or online posts. This false statement damages the person's reputation or causes harm to their standing in the community. To qualify as libel, the statement must be proven to be false, made intentionally or negligently, and result in injury. It is different from slander, which involves spoken false statements. Legal action can be taken if someone believes they've been libeled and their reputation has been unfairly harmed.
